8 Ways How React Native Reduce Cross Platform App Development Cost
Sector: Digital Product, Technology
Author: Sweta Patel
Date Published: 08/05/2021
Contents
Developing an app is a costly and time-consuming process. However, thanks to technologies like React Native, it’s becoming easier and more affordable to create cross-platform apps. In this article, we will take a look at 8 ways React Native can help reduce the cost of app development.
Keep reading to find out more about how much does a react native app costs!
Why does React Native consider a Cost-successful Mobile App Development Platform?
Different elements choose the expense of an application, for example, extension and necessity of the application wanted the foundation of the applications, application class, specific designers, and advancement time and exertion.
We can diminish the cost of react native app development through the underneath highlights, which ends up making React Native a highly cost-effective mobile app development platform.
1. Faster Development
The advancement time by implication adds to the expense of the portable application. Fostering a portable application for two distinct stages is quite difficult for the business, expecting you to foster the application in the devoted language and superfluously contributing a similar measure of time and assets twice.
React Native frees the engineers from re-composing the whole code from the scratch for the stages, permitting them to assemble it for two unique stages only by choosing its sort from the choices. Doing this, React Native will in general save a ton of improvement time, which can be used in some other useful work.
2. Easily Maintainable
To refresh your application, you should present the refreshed code and application form to the application store and afterward hang tight for the application to execute it.
React Native engages you to refresh your application distantly without intruding on the client’s application utilization, making the application upkeep simpler and less tedious. The element is useful for the clients too, as they need not download the refreshed forms of the application from the play store.
The end of application development diminishes the direct support cost and even indirectly trims down the React Native developers cost.
3. Reusable Components
The cross-platform nature of React Native permits the engineers to reuse the parts reciprocally inside both the platforms that are Android and iOS. In this way, whenever you have composed a JavaScript code for your application for one stage, you can straightforwardly assemble and reuse it for the other, ultimately decreasing the advancement cost and time.
For example, a similar code can be utilized for versatile applications just as the work area web sees. This helps the developers using the facilities to assemble the related codes. The lesser the code, the speedier the turn of events, bring down the expense!
4. Real-Time Testing
React Native includes application testing through Fast Refresh which will in general accelerate the application advancement measure. Quick Refresh makes it much simpler and quicker to prompt any change in the application codebase.
With the quick invigorate, you need not revive, test, and gather the whole application each time you carry out a solitary change inside the application codebase and React Native does this consequently for you. Subsequently, the structure naturally revives the application and mirrors its change at whatever point you roll out an improvement. This way you can test your progressions live and fix the blunders whenever required.
5. Seamless Integration with the Native Application
While fostering a portable application that incorporates local usefulness, the significant test is its similarity with the local applications like camera and GPS. React Native is known for its stupendous local application similarity, freeing the engineers from the pressure of incorporating the local application with their application.
As React Native offers consistent application coordination without hampering the exhibition of the application, the engineers need not foster the modules independently or put any additional work into the application incorporation. This adds to the expense viability of the system.
6. No more Additional Resources Required
Fostering an application expects you to consider different factors like the ideal stage, recruiting committed engineers with specific abilities, keeping up with discrete codebases for the applications. Being a cross-stage structure, React Native works on the cycle for you.
This adds to the expense viability of React Native, freeing you to pay additional cash to employ devoted engineers for every stage, contributing additional chances to keep up with the codebase independently, and cloning the local applications for your applications.
7. Enormous React Native Component Libraries
React Native accompanies a humongous UI segment Library, and alongside this, it likewise permits the designers to utilize outsider libraries too. This diminishes the designers’ responsibility, exertion, and season by permitting them to utilize the previous segments from the actual libraries, at least lessening the expense of the application.
8. Solution for UI/UX
UI/UX is the initial feeling an application makes on its clients. Planning local applications for Android and iOS independently calls for tactful contemplations for UI/UX. Here, React Native strides in. Since it empowers cross-stage similarity, the need to stress over prudent UX/UX is gone.
How do React Native aides stack your application quicker?
The following are the valuable tips that can endlessly work on the proficiency of your application and helps in stacking quicker –
- Forestall exorbitant re-renders
- Use <FlatList>, <SectionList>, <VirtualizedList> rather than <ListView>, <ScrollView>
- Make sure to overhaul React Native to the freshest variant
- Decrease Application Size
- Advance your pictures
Why do Businesses and Famous Companies Build Their Apps with React Native?
React Native delivers a slick, seamless, and highly responsive UI while essentially trimming down the overall load time. It is quicker to develop apps in React Native compared to crafting native ones, without the requirement to negotiate on advanced features and higher development quality.
Furthermore, it is much easier to reduce the cost to build a react native app. Let us explore and analyze why some of the leading organizations selected React Native.
How Techtic Solutions Can Help You Reduce React Native App Development Cost?
So, React Native applications lower your development and sustenance costs, as you don’t have to manage various codebases for Android and iOS. Techtic Solutions is a leading application development company that has an explicit edge in trimming down react native app development costs.
At Techtic, we believe no single technique fits all, and multiple factors facilitate React Native cost reduction. If you require to build an application for both Android and iOS, React Native is the best technology platform.
If you have a splendid application idea and concept, get in touch with us. We have a professional and proficient team of React Native app developers with immense experience in developing robust and scalable React Native apps.
Latest Tech Insights!
Join our newsletter for the latest updates, tips, and trends.